| Shoulder amplitude movement does not influence postoperative wound complications after breast cancer surgery: a randomized clinical trial |
| Gomes Chagas Teodozio C, de Oliveira Marchito L, Alves Nogueira Fabro E, Oliveira Macedo FO, Sales de Aguiar S, Santos Thuler LC, Bergmann A |
| Breast Cancer Research and Treatment 2020 Nov;184(1):97-105 |
| clinical trial |
| 7/10 [Eligibility criteria: Yes; Random allocation: Yes; Concealed allocation: Yes; Baseline comparability: Yes; Blind subjects: No; Blind therapists: No; Blind assessors: No; Adequate follow-up: Yes; Intention-to-treat analysis: Yes; Between-group comparisons: Yes; Point estimates and variability: Yes. Note: Eligibility criteria item does not contribute to total score] *This score has been confirmed* |
